Transaction
e3ad32ee32229a83004741e9b4cac90aa19a3a3203a6e412dfe1dce653680cb5

Block
Time
6/26/2019 8:34:44 PM
Version
2
Size
65 B
Confirmations
3018693

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L
#0
Coinbase